Encore AI Raises $30M to Train Sales Agents on Real Customer Calls
Encore AI has raised $30 million to develop AI agents that learn from customer interactions. The startup analyzes calls, messages, and CRM data to extract effective sales techniques and convert them into playbooks that train AI agents. This approach aims to automate and scale sales processes by codifying human expertise.

Why It Matters
This represents a shift toward AI systems that learn from real-world business performance rather than generic training data. By extracting playbooks from actual successful interactions, Encore AI addresses a practical gap in enterprise AI: how to embed domain-specific expertise and proven tactics into automated agents. This approach could reshape how companies scale their sales operations.
Business Impact
Sales teams face constant pressure to maintain consistency and scale without proportional headcount growth. Encore AI's model offers a way to codify top performer techniques and apply them across teams through AI agents, potentially improving conversion rates and reducing training time for new reps. The ability to continuously learn from call data creates a feedback loop that could compound competitive advantage over time.
